There's no place like home for Bay City,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Tuesday. Their pitchers stepped up to hand the Wharton Tigers a 5-0 shutout on Tuesday. The win continues a trend for the Blackcats in their matchups with the Tigers: they've now won three in a row.
Bay City saw five different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Lexiana Dickerson, who scored two runs while going 2-for-4. Ameris Huerta also deserves some recognition as she snagged her first stolen bases of the season.

Bay City's victory bumped their record up to 8-13. As for Wharton, they are on a five-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 3-11.
Looking ahead, Bay City will host Needville at 5:30 p.m. on Friday. The Bluejays will roll in looking for their 14th straight win, something the Blackcats surely won't give up without a fight. As for Wharton, they will have a little extra prep time after the defeat as they won't be playing again for a while. They'll take on Brazosport at 5:00 p.m. on the 15th.
